So you buy a customer, who then creates a revenue stream. So you have to figure out the cost and the margin each month, then see how long the customer has to stay for you to turn a profit. If the break-even point is nine-to-12 months away and the customer stays with you for two years, then that will work.

Unless you let someone know what action has been taken, the customer is never going to perceive a difference. You've got to close the loop. If the customer isn't aware of the fix, then the remedy doesn't exist.
